PICTORIAL: VP Shettima Delivers Al-Hikmah Varsity’s 13th Convocation Lecture In Kwara

Vice President Kashim Shettima, on Saturday, delivered the 13th Convocation Lecture of Al-Hikmah University, Ilorin, Kwara State, where underscored the role of education and training of the country’s population to take full advantage of what he described as the growing influence of technology in all aspects of human existence.

Vice President Shettima particularly identified agricultural revolution as the only bold step Nigeria can take to put an end to insecurity and reduce poverty among its growing population.

This, he said, can be achieved through the deployment of technology to actualise food security among the country’s growing population, noting that it is where the university comes to extract the maximum benefits from the right synergy that is consistent with its own peculiarities.

The Vice President, who had earlier commissioned the newly-constructed Faculty of Nursing Complex of Al-Hikmah University named after him, thanked the management of the school, saying he was profoundly moved by the gesture and would cherish the honour as the most humbling act of generosity.

In addition to inaugurating the Senator Kashim Shettima Nursing Science Complex, the Vice President also officially opened the University’s Faculty of Law Moot Court Complex at the Atere Campus of the University.

Dignitaries at the convocation ceremony included the governor of Kwara State, A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q; the deputy governor of Kwara State, Kayode Alabi; Inspector General of Police, Kayode Egbetokun; the Special Adviser to the President on Political Matters (Office of the Vice President), Dr Hakeem Baba-Ahmed; the Pro-Chancellor and Chairman of Council, Al-Hikmah University, Alhaja Sekinat Yusuf; the Registrar of the University; the Founder of the University, Alhaji (Dr.) AbdulRaheem Oladimeji, and Senators representing Kwara State at the National Assembly, among others.
